Eric R Mack

User Eric R Mack

User Operations and Facilities Manager

User831-459-4078

User techie@ucsc.edu

he, him, his, his, himself

Arts Division

Operations and Facilities Manager

Staff

Other Staff

Theater Arts A Main Stage
A208

Onsite Monday through Friday 8am to 4pm, evenings and weekends as needed for productions.

Theater Arts Center

Last modified: Sep 15, 2024